What activities most dominated life on a manor in Europe?​

Social Studies
1 answer:
Helga [31]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

Explanation:

All the peasants in the Middle Ages surrounded the manor. A manor is an area of land that was owned by the feudal lord. The lords either lived in manor houses or castles. Other than the village, there were forest/woods that were used for hunting, fields, owned by lords, used for crops, a church, grain mills and a barn.

this type of general purpose seeks to "attempt to change, reinforce, modify, or change audience members, beliefs, attitudes, opi
lara [203]

Answer:

To persuade.

Explanation:

The general purpose of a speech is, as the name suggests, the overall goal you wish to achieve with it. There can be three types of general purposes: to entertain, to inform, and to persuade. When you seek to change, reinforce, modify beliefs, attitudes, opinions, values, and behaviors, your general purpose is to persuade.

Suppose you're writing a speech in which you describe how quitting smoking can be beneficial to people's health. You want to convince your audience that, if they quit smoking as soon as possible, they will decrease the likelihood of cancer and their general quality of life will greatly increase. Your general purpose is to persuade. Your specific purpose is clearly to persuade people to stop smoking. You want to change their beliefs and behaviors.

What did William Few do to help georgia?
satela [25.4K]

Answer:

In 1796 Few was appointed as a federal judge for the Georgia circuit. During this three-year appointment he not only consolidated his reputation as a practical, fair jurist but became a prominent supporter of public education. He was a founding trustee of the University of Georgia (UGA) in Athens in 1785.
